More Than Just a Game: Spelling, Vocabulary, Focus

At first glance, a word search seems like a straightforward game of “find the word.” But beneath its simple surface lies a potent developmental activity. When a child searches for a word like “watermelon,” they are not only recognizing its shape but also internalizing its correct spelling. This repeated exposure and active engagement with words cement their memory, improving both recognition and recall. Furthermore, word searches introduce children to new vocabulary in a low-stakes, interactive context. A word list might include “snorkel,” “frisbee,” or “camping,” prompting curiosity and leading to questions about their meanings, thereby expanding their lexicon naturally. The act of sustained searching also cultivates vital skills in concentration and focus, training young minds to sift through information and identify specific targets, a skill transferable to many areas of academic and life success.

Benefits Across Age Groups: Differentiated Difficulty Levels

One of the greatest advantages of summer word searches is their versatility. They can be easily adapted to suit various developmental stages, making them suitable for almost any child.

  • For Young Learners (Ages 4-6): Easy word searches typically feature fewer words (5-10), larger fonts, and words that only run horizontally or vertically (left to right, or top to bottom). The words are often short, common summer-themed terms like “sun,” “swim,” “park,” or “sand.” This gentle introduction helps them recognize letter patterns, differentiate between letters, and build confidence in their emerging reading skills.
  • For Early Elementary (Ages 7-9): Medium-difficulty puzzles introduce more words (15-20), a slightly smaller grid, and words that might also appear backward horizontally or vertically. Vocabulary expands to include words like “picnic,” “baseball,” “garden,” or “vacation.” These puzzles challenge them to apply their growing phonics and sight-word knowledge more broadly.
  • For Older Children (Ages 10+): Harder word searches can include 30 or more words, smaller fonts, and words hidden in all directions—horizontal, vertical, diagonal, and backward. The vocabulary becomes more complex, featuring words like “adventure,” “kayaking,” “fireflies,” or “barbecue.” These advanced puzzles demand higher levels of visual discrimination, sustained attention, and strategic thinking.

This adaptability ensures that every child can experience the joy of accomplishment, finding a puzzle that perfectly matches their skill level and encouraging continued engagement.

Vocabulary Expansion: Encountering New Words

One of the most immediate and impactful benefits of word searches is their role in vocabulary expansion. When children encounter new words in a word list – perhaps “aquatic,” “constellation,” or “sizzling” in a summer-themed puzzle – they are exposed to terms they might not encounter in their everyday speech. This exposure acts as a gentle introduction, sparking curiosity. Parents can enhance this by discussing the meaning of each word, putting it into a sentence, or relating it to a summer experience. This interactive learning not only adds new words to their active vocabulary but also strengthens their overall language comprehension.

Spelling Reinforcement: Visual Recognition

For many children, spelling can be a challenging skill. Word searches offer a playful, repetitive way to reinforce correct spelling. As a child searches for “swimming,” their brain registers the sequence of “S-W-I-M-M-I-N-G” multiple times. This visual repetition, coupled with the active task of finding the word, helps cement the correct letter order in their memory. It’s a hands-on approach to spelling practice that doesn’t feel like traditional rote memorization, making it more effective and enjoyable. The more they see and identify correctly spelled words, the better their recall will be when they write those words themselves.

Concentration and Focus: Sustained Attention

In an age of constant stimulation, the ability to concentrate and maintain focus is an increasingly vital skill. Word searches demand sustained attention. Children must focus on a specific word, keep it in their short-term memory, and then systematically scan a grid of distracting letters until they find the target. This process trains their brain to filter out irrelevant information and stay committed to a task. Starting with easier puzzles and gradually increasing the difficulty helps build this “attention muscle,” improving their ability to concentrate for longer periods and tackle more complex challenges, both inside and outside the classroom.

Problem-Solving Skills: Strategy and Persistence

Completing a word search is, at its heart, a problem-solving exercise. Children learn to develop strategies: Do they scan row by row? Column by column? Search for the first letter of each word? Or look for unique letter combinations? They also learn persistence – not giving up when a word is particularly tricky to find. This cultivates a growth mindset, teaching them that effort and different approaches can lead to success. Each found word provides a small win, building confidence and encouraging them to tackle the next challenge with renewed determination.

Fine Motor Skills (for Printable Versions): Pencil Grip, Coordination

While online word searches offer convenience, printable versions bring an additional physical benefit: the development of fine motor skills. Holding a pencil, carefully circling a word, and navigating the grid with precision all contribute to improving hand-eye coordination and pencil grip. These are foundational skills crucial for handwriting, drawing, and many other daily tasks. The tactile experience of marking off words also adds another dimension of engagement, making the activity more multi-sensory and reinforcing the learning process.

Thematic Puzzles: Beach, Sports, Food, Nature

Summer offers a rich tapestry of themes, and word searches capitalize on this by featuring vocabulary related to specific summer activities. You can find puzzles centered around:

  • Beach & Ocean: Words like “seashell,” “sandcastle,” “waves,” “dolphin.”
  • Summer Sports: “Baseball,” “swimming,” “frisbee,” “cycling.”
  • Summer Foods: “Ice cream,” “lemonade,” “watermelon,” “barbecue.”
  • Nature & Outdoors: “Butterflies,” “camping,” “hiking,” “fireflies.”

These themes make the puzzles more relatable and enjoyable, connecting the abstract act of word-finding to concrete summer experiences. They also provide natural conversation starters, allowing parents to engage children in discussions about the words they find, further cementing their understanding and usage.

Printable vs. Online: Pros and Cons

Both printable and online word searches have their merits:

  • Printable Word Searches:
    • Pros: Develops fine motor skills, requires no screen time, can be taken anywhere (car rides, picnics), offers a tactile experience.
    • Cons: Requires a printer, ink, and paper; cannot be endlessly replayed without reprinting.
  • Online Word Searches:
    • Pros: Convenient, interactive elements, often self-correcting, eco-friendly (no paper), readily accessible on devices.
    • Cons: Involves screen time, may not engage fine motor skills as much, can be distracting for some children.

The best approach often involves a balance. Printable puzzles are excellent for focused, hands-on learning, while online versions can offer quick, accessible bursts of fun. Both contribute positively to learning in different ways.

Creating Your Own: Customization for Specific Learning Goals

For parents or educators seeking a truly personalized learning experience, creating your own summer word searches is a fantastic option. Many free online tools allow you to input your own word list, instantly generating a custom puzzle. This is particularly beneficial for:

  • Targeting Specific Sounds: If your child is working on a particular sound (e.g., /s/ or /r/), you can create a puzzle focused on summer words containing those sounds (e.g., “sun,” “sand,” “slide,” or “river,” “read,” “rainbow”).
  • Reinforcing School Vocabulary: Use words from their upcoming grade level reading lists to give them a head start.
  • Introducing New Concepts: Build a puzzle around a new topic they’re learning about, like different types of clouds or historical figures.

This level of customization ensures that the word search is not just a general activity but a targeted tool aligned with your child’s specific developmental needs and interests.
